In Florida, the cost of a bail bond is strictly regulated by state law under Florida Statute 648.44. The premium is set at a non-refundable 10% of the total bail amount (with a $100 minimum per charge). Because this rate is legally mandated, any agency offering "cheap bail," discounts, or "no money down" deals is operating illegally and should be treated as a major red flag.
